PHP Classes

File: .phpspec/specification.tpl

Recommend this page to a friend!
  Classes of Michael Cummings   PHP Event Mediator   .phpspec/specification.tpl   Download  
File: .phpspec/specification.tpl
Role: Auxiliary data
Content type: text/plain
Description: Auxiliary data
Class: PHP Event Mediator
Emit and listen to events using a mediator object
Author: By
Last change: Updated *.tpl file with new copyright info and fixed some formatting.
Date: 7 years ago
Size: 1,482 bytes
 

Contents

Class file image Download
<?php /** * Contains PhpSpec class %name%. * * PHP version 7.0 * * LICENSE: * This file is part of Event Mediator - A general event mediator (dispatcher) * which has minimal dependencies so it is easy to drop in and use. * Copyright (C) 2015-2016 Michael Cummings * * This program is free software; you can redistribute it and/or modify it * under the terms of the GNU General Public License as published by the Free * Software Foundation; version 2 of the License. * * This program is distributed in the hope that it will be useful, but WITHOUT * 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S * FOR A PARTICULAR PURPOSE. See the GNU General Public License for more * details. * * You should have received a copy of the GNU General Public License along with * this program; if not, you may write to * * Free Software Foundation, Inc. * 59 Temple Place, Suite 330 * Boston, MA 02111-1307 USA * * or find a electronic copy at * <http://spdx.org/licenses/GPL-2.0.html>. * * You should also be able to find a copy of this license in the included * LICENSE file. * * @author Michael Cummings <mgcummings@yahoo.com> * @copyright 2015-2016 Michael Cummings * @license GPL-2.0 */ namespace %namespace%; use PhpSpec\ObjectBehavior; use Prophecy\Argument; /** * Class %name% */ class %name% extends ObjectBehavior { public function it_is_initializable() { $this->shouldHaveType('%subject%'); } }